What time/mileage frame are we dealing with? If there is no oil trails under vehical, it is likely burning it and some engine can burn a good bit of oil without much trace. YOu might also try a heavier grade of oil in warmer months to see if it helps in a worn engine, I have had good luck with 15w40 (not 10w40) in worn engine in warmer weather in controlling oil consumption. all 15w40 oil is rated diesel and gas and seem to work better than a straight automotive oil in a worn engine.
I have a '94 also, and for what it's worth, Toyota's official answer is oil use of 1 quart in 1,000 miles is not considered a problem.
